The question is simple. "Which 150 names tell the Rovers story? From 1875 to 2025…" ⚪️🔵 These can be heroes, villains, players, officials, owners, fans. Any person who you feel is integral to Rovers past, present and future - to go onto a DEFINITIVE LIST as chosen by BRFCS Members. For posterity, for lively discussion and debate…& quite possibly…merchandise 😉 There is currently a “shortlist” (!) of 225 names*. The Polls will be split into eight different eras. And will be open from Wednesday to Wednesday for the next eight weeks. Part One: The Foundation Years - 1875-1900 - (15th October - 22nd October) Part Two: 20th Century and Post World War I - 1900-1930 - (22nd October - 29th October) Part Three: Inter War and Post World War II - 1930-1950 (29th October - 5th November) Part Four: The Boomer Generation - 1950 - 1970 (5th November - 12th November) Part Five: The Seventies and Eighties - 1970 - 1992 (12th November - 19th November) Part Six: The Jack Walker Era - 1992 - 2000 (19th November - 26th November) Part Seven: The Walker Trust Era - 2000 - 2012 (26th November - 3rd December) Part Eight: The Venky's Era - 2012 - 2025 (3rd December - 10th December) Your job as a Forum, is to help us whittle down these suggestions by choosing who you think deserves to make our definitive list. You can vote as many times as you like (but we suggest no more than say, 5 votes per list), only the top voted names/figures will make the final cut. *This list has been created by myself and has been corroborated with the help of @Herbie6590 @4,000 Holes @Fred Cumpstey along with several other fans and commentators on and off the message boards. From Rovers perspective this for me was the proverbial game of two halves. For the first 40 or so minutes we dominated the ball, passed it well, were aggressive, on the front foot and played at a good tempo. The two goals we got were in my opinion not reflective of our dominance. Those two goals were almost opposites with Doherty rattling one in from distance and Joseph with an easy header from close range. In a rare foray forward Preston scored a goal just before half-time but it certainly looked like a deliberate handball in the penalty area skirmish just prior. That goal seemed to rattle us and Batty spent some time with the match officials on the pitch after the half time whistle. All the good things we were doing earlier seemed to disappear as Preston seemed to sense our unease. However we defended stoically and Honor in goal is looking better every time I see him. It wasn't until the last ten minutes when Preston were bombing on that we looked like scoring again. In the end we were probably a touch fortunate but a win is a win. Aside from Honor Atcheson looked good I thought with Joesph showing some good strikers attributes although he does, in my view get overly involved with centre halves and plays on the edge in this respect.
